Ron, instead of overwriting the default model just stick the modified model in a folder called model.1
Then you just put in model=1 and it will read the model from the model.1 folder just like it does with texture sets :)
Heres an example from my Baron(my first one :-lol)

[fltsim.1]
title=Beech Baron 58 ZK-ZXT
sim=Beech_Baron_58
model=1
panel=
sound=
texture=zxt
kb_checklists=Beech_Baron_58_check
kb_reference=Beech_Baron_58_ref
atc_id=ZK-ZXT
ui_manufacturer=Beechcraft
ui_type=Baron 58
ui_variation=Red with Blue - ZK-ZXT
description=With the wonderful control harmony that is the hallmark of the Bonanza line, the Beech Baron 58 is considered a classic light twin. The Baron 58 is the spiffed-up version of a time-tested favorite, made more modern by its new Continental Special engines. The Baron combines the attractiveness of Beechcraft design with the reliability of twin engines, resulting in a gorgeous workhorse of an aircraft.
